96898-2
LaboratorySARS-CoV-2 (COVID-19) N gene [Cycle Threshold #] in Oropharyngeal wash by NAA with probe detection
Definition
Quantitative detection (Cq/Ct value) of nucleic acids within the nucleoprotein (N) gene from SARS co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) in oropharyngeal wash (oral rinse, gargle) samples by nucleic acid amplification (NAA) with probe-based detection methods.

What is LOINC?
L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
